Supertex has the Highest PEG Ratio in the Semiconductors Industry (SUPX, RFMD, CREE, TXN, LSCC)


Apr 29, 2013 (SmarTrend(R) News Watch via COMTEX) -- Below are the three companies in the Semiconductors industry with the highest price to earnings to growth (PEG) ratios. PEG is valuable in assessing the tradeoff between the price of a stock and expected growth. Generally, the lower the PEG, the better.



Supertex ranks highest with a a PEG ratio of 2.52. Following is RF Micro Devices with a a PEG ratio of 2.40. Cree ranks third highest with a a PEG ratio of 2.37.

Texas Instruments follows with a a PEG ratio of 2.24, and Lattice Semiconductor rounds out the top five with a a PEG ratio of 2.12.
